Project Manager

Kamran & Company is a leading commercial food service equipment dealer and design-build contractor serving casinos, stadiums, hospitals, and hospitality venues nationwide. With over 34 years of industry leadership and $1B+ in completed project value, we deliver the full lifecycle of commercial food service — from specification and design through procurement and installation.

We are a PE-backed platform company with four retail banners and a robust project and contract business. Our Project Managers are at the center of that delivery — leading complex, high-value projects that define our reputation in the market.

Key Responsibilities
  • Own the project from award to closeout. Manage all phases of assigned projects with full accountability for schedule, budget, and client satisfaction. No handoffs — you own it start to finish.
  • Build and hold the schedule. Develop detailed project plans with sequenced milestones, procurement lead times, installation windows, and inspection requirements. Maintain schedule discipline throughout execution.
  • Manage the budget. Establish project budgets, track actuals against cost-to-complete, and manage buyout to protect margin. Flag variances early and take corrective action before they become problems.
  • Drive change order discipline. Identify, document, and price all scope changes. Ensure change orders are captured, approved, and billed. Unexecuted scope changes are a margin leak — you close that gap.
  • Coordinate the full project team. Work with internal Project Coordinators, field installers, fabrication shop coordination, and subcontractors. Everyone on the project knows their role and what is expected.
  • Serve as the primary client contact. Own the client relationship from kickoff through final acceptance. Proactive communication, accurate status updates, and fast resolution of issues are non-negotiable.
  • Interface with GCs and ownership groups. Represent Kamran & Company at owner meetings, OAC meetings, and site coordination calls. Communicate with authority and precision.
  • Manage submittals and RFIs. Oversee the submittal process, track RFI responses, and ensure design and procurement decisions are made on time to protect the schedule.
  • Deliver structured status reporting. Maintain clear, current project dashboards and provide regular written updates to internal leadership and clients. No surprises.
  • Own the WIP on your projects. Work with the FP&A Analyst and Accounting to ensure your projects have accurate cost-to-complete estimates, current billing positions, and no stale data in the WIP report.
  • Manage AIA billing. Prepare and submit timely AIA applications for payment. Understand percentage-of-completion mechanics and ensure billing reflects true project progress.
  • Protect margin through procurement. Drive buyout discipline — identify savings versus estimate and flag exposure. Every dollar of buyout savings is a dollar of margin protected.
  • Track and close retainage. Pursue retainage release proactively ainage sitting idle is cash that belongs to the company.
  • Follow project process standards. Adhere to documentation standards, update cadences, and WIP accuracy on your projects.
  • Contribute to PM process improvement. Identify workflow gaps, tool improvements, and process breakdowns. Bring solutions, not just observations.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, Architecture, Business, or related field required.
  • 3+ years of project management experience in commercial construction, food service equipment, or related contracting environment.
  • Track record managing projects from $500K to $5M with accountability for schedule and budget.
  • Proficiency with AIA billing, percentage-of-completion accounting, and subcontract management.
  • Strong working knowledge of construction documents, submittal processes, RFI management, and closeout procedures.
  • Exceptional communication skills — written and verbal — at the owner, GC, and trade level.
  • High organizational discipline and the ability to manage multiple active projects simultaneously without sacrificing detail.
